QA / QA Automation
Какие типы ожиданий ты можешь перечислить в контексте разработки программного обеспечения?
Имел ли опыт взаимодействия с командной строкой или терминальной средой?
Почему и в каких случаях используют заглушки для запросов в тестировании?
Ты обычно работаешь с командной строкой при управлении репозиториями Git?
Применяешь ли ты оператор HAVING в своих SQL-запросах?
Можете объяснить принцип работы неявных ожиданий в Selenium и как они влияют на выполнение автоматизированных тестов?
Можно ли рассказать о вашем опыте использования различных систем обмена сообщениями и их особенностях?
Можешь объяснить, что происходит при выполнении команды push в Git?
Какие HTTP-методы обеспечивают идемпотентность при повторных запросах?
Можешь перечислить основные типы соединений таблиц в SQL и их различия?
Какой у вас опыт проведения нагрузочного тестирования и анализа его результатов?
Чем отличаются виды тестирования Smoke, Regress и Sanity по своей цели и применению?
Можно ли привести примеры тестирования, соответствующие различным уровням пирамиды тестирования?
Можете объяснить различия между протоколами SOAP и REST в контексте реализации веб-сервисов?
Имели ли вы опыт создания REST API с нуля, начиная с проектирования архитектуры?
Используешь ли ты принцип инкапсуляции при разработке своих проектов?
Чем отличаются команды HAVING и WHERE в SQL-запросах и в каких случаях их используют?
Можете объяснить, что подразумевается под HTTP GET-запросом?
Какие компоненты или функции можно получить или унаследовать при создании подкласса от базового класса в Python?
Можешь объяснить разные типы соединений в SQL и их особенности?